How To Future-Proof Your Lian Li Dan A4-H2O Water-Cooled Pc

Building a water-cooled PC with the Lian Li Dan A4-H2O case is an excellent choice for enthusiasts seeking high performance and a sleek aesthetic. However, to ensure your system remains relevant and capable of handling future upgrades, future-proofing is essential. Here are key strategies to help you achieve a durable and adaptable build.

Select a Future-Ready CPU and Motherboard

Start with a high-quality CPU that supports upcoming technologies. Opt for the latest generation processors from Intel or AMD, ensuring compatibility with future socket and chipset updates. Pair this with a motherboard that offers multiple PCIe slots, M.2 slots, and robust VRM support to accommodate future upgrades.

Invest in Modular and Upgradable Components

Choose RAM modules with higher capacities and faster speeds, and select a power supply unit (PSU) with ample wattage and modular cables. Modular PSUs facilitate easier upgrades and replacements. Also, consider future-proof storage options like NVMe SSDs, which offer rapid data transfer speeds.

Optimize Cooling for Future Hardware

The Lian Li Dan A4-H2O case excels in water cooling, which is inherently adaptable. Plan your cooling loop with extra radiator space and additional fittings to accommodate future GPU or CPU upgrades. Use high-quality, scalable water blocks compatible with upcoming hardware.

Plan for Additional Radiators and Reservoirs

Design your cooling loop with extra radiator mounting points and reservoir capacity. This allows you to upgrade or add components without extensive modifications. Efficient cooling ensures your hardware remains cool under increased performance demands.

Choose a Flexible Graphics Card Strategy

GPU technology evolves rapidly. Select a graphics card that fits your current needs but is also compatible with upcoming PCIe standards. Consider a GPU with a robust power delivery system and support for future driver updates.

Implement Effective Cable Management and Accessibility

Ensure your build has excellent cable management to facilitate airflow and make future upgrades easier. The compact nature of the Dan A4-H2O requires thoughtful routing. Use removable panels and accessible ports for quick component swaps.

Regular Maintenance and Monitoring

Keep your system clean and monitor temperatures regularly. Upgrading components becomes smoother when your cooling system is well-maintained. Use software tools to track system performance and plan upgrades proactively.

Stay Informed on Emerging Technologies

Follow hardware manufacturers and tech news to stay updated on new components and standards. Being aware of upcoming innovations allows you to plan timely upgrades, extending the lifespan of your build.
